Why conduct Safety Training?

According to Safe Work Australia, “A workplace that is not healthy and safe may have to face insurance claims, medical bills, higher insurance premiums, replacement labour costs and lost productive time.”

To add to this, the law states that as an employer and PCBU, you are responsible for providing health and safety information to your employees, team and contractors. Failing this responsibility can result in serious consequences.

Overall, creating a safe and healthy working environment does save lives.

Crystalline Silica Awareness

Did you know that from 1st September 2024, you’re legally required to provide silica training to any worker involved in the processing of a crystalline silica substance (CSS) or anyone at risk of exposure to respirable crystalline silica (RCS) due to processing?
